Transaction 966ab37d84e524f493cdb6f4ee8d1405d9f784e7534737ddc15227a3fcf23c8f
1 Input
1 Output
-
966ab37d84e524f493cdb6f4ee8d1405d9f784e7534737ddc15227a3fcf23c8f:0
- value
- 6548240
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a80e9026bdf938b79ab0604661178df74d06d2c OP_EQUAL
- address
- 3EKMbrTm4UTns9UoVVykWRUHtNLjdBrSNQ